Output edcf8d21ac826da4495a1b598116c462e0cf5d804947331d2e7d52fd60d3db16:2

value
117606
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 352d9dade75560cfc3f4b932e48392824820282f OP_EQUALVERIFY OP_CHECKSIG
address
15rBTcq2wsYbCD2D58ZCzpRdippkadbmpV
transaction
edcf8d21ac826da4495a1b598116c462e0cf5d804947331d2e7d52fd60d3db16
spent
true